ABB PFTL201C 50KN 3BSE007913R50 Industrial Load Cell Overview

The ABB PFTL201C 50KN, identified by part number 3BSE007913R50, is a high-precision industrial load cell designed for force measurement and tension control applications in automated production systems. It is engineered to deliver stable, accurate, and repeatable measurement results in demanding industrial environments where mechanical force control is critical for product quality and process stability.

Role in Industrial Force Measurement Systems

The PFTL201C load cell is used to measure mechanical force in real time and convert it into electrical signals that can be interpreted by automation control systems. These signals are then used to regulate tension levels in continuous production processes such as web handling, winding systems, and material processing lines.

In industrial environments, precise force measurement is essential for maintaining consistent product quality. The ABB PFTL201C ensures that tension values remain within defined operating ranges, reducing material deformation, breakage, and production inconsistencies.

Operating Principle and Measurement Technology

The load cell operates based on strain gauge measurement principles, where applied mechanical force causes deformation within the sensing element. This deformation is converted into electrical resistance changes, which are then processed into calibrated force output signals.

The ABB PFTL201C is designed to maintain high linearity and repeatability across its full measurement range, ensuring reliable performance even under continuous industrial load conditions. Its measurement accuracy supports closed-loop control systems requiring real-time feedback.

Integration in Automation Systems

The ABB PFTL201C integrates into industrial automation systems as part of tension control architectures. It is commonly used together with ABB controllers and drive systems to form a complete feedback loop for process regulation.

The load cell transmits force measurement data to control units, which adjust machine parameters such as motor speed, torque, or material feed rate. This integration ensures stable process control and reduces manual intervention in industrial operations.

Industrial Application Areas

The PFTL201C is widely used in industries requiring precise tension control, including paper manufacturing, textile production, plastic film processing, metal strip handling, and packaging systems.

In paper production, it ensures uniform web tension to prevent tearing or uneven thickness. In textile applications, it maintains consistent fabric tension. In metal processing, it supports controlled rolling and winding operations.

Performance Stability and Reliability

The ABB PFTL201C is engineered for continuous operation in harsh industrial environments. It maintains stable measurement output under varying temperature conditions, mechanical stress, and long-term operational loads.

Its robust construction ensures durability and long service life, making it suitable for critical production environments where downtime must be minimized and measurement consistency is essential.

System-Level Benefits

By providing accurate real-time force measurement, the PFTL201C improves overall system efficiency and process stability. It enables automation systems to respond dynamically to changes in material tension, reducing waste and improving production quality.

The integration of precise load measurement into control loops enhances machine coordination and reduces operational errors, contributing to higher productivity in automated manufacturing systems.
